Samsung Galaxy Tab A7 Lite vs. Tecno Spark 10 5G: A Practical Comparison
These two devices serve different purposes—one is a budget tablet, the other a budget 5G smartphone. But if you're torn between a larger screen and better performance, this breakdown will help you decide.
1. Specifications Breakdown
Design & Build
Feature | Samsung Galaxy Tab A7 Lite | Tecno Spark 10 5G | Real-World Implications |
---|---|---|---|
Dimensions | 212.5 × 124.7 × 8 mm | 164.4 × 75.5 × 8.4 mm | The Tab A7 Lite is much larger—better for media, worse for portability. |
Weight | 366g | (Data missing) | The tablet is heavier, making it less pocket-friendly. |
Fingerprint Sensor | No | Side-mounted | The Spark 10 5G offers better security and convenience. |
Display
Feature | Samsung Galaxy Tab A7 Lite | Tecno Spark 10 5G | Real-World Implications |
---|---|---|---|
Size | 8.7" TFT LCD | 6.6" IPS LCD | The tablet wins for movies, reading, and multitasking. |
Resolution | 800 × 1340 (179 PPI) | 720 × 1612 (267 PPI) | The Spark 10 5G is sharper, but the tablet’s size compensates. |
Refresh Rate | 60Hz | 90Hz | Smoother scrolling and animations on the Spark 10 5G. |
Performance
Feature | Samsung Galaxy Tab A7 Lite | Tecno Spark 10 5G | Real-World Implications |
---|---|---|---|
Chipset | Mediatek Helio P22T (12nm) | Dimensity 6020 (7nm) | The Spark 10 5G is 3x faster (AnTuTu 331K vs. 103K). |
RAM | 3GB / 4GB | 8GB | The Spark 10 5G handles multitasking and gaming much better. |
Storage | 32GB / 64GB | 256GB | The Spark 10 5G offers far more space for apps and media. |
Camera
Feature | Samsung Galaxy Tab A7 Lite | Tecno Spark 10 5G | Real-World Implications |
---|---|---|---|
Main Camera | 8MP (f/2.0) | 50MP (f/1.6) | The Spark 10 5G takes much better photos. |
Selfie Camera | 2MP (f/2.2) | 8MP (f/1.8) | The Spark 10 5G is better for video calls and selfies. |
Slow-Motion Video | No | 240fps | The Spark 10 5G offers more creative video options. |
Battery & Charging
Feature | Samsung Galaxy Tab A7 Lite | Tecno Spark 10 5G | Real-World Implications |
---|---|---|---|
Capacity | 5100mAh | 5000mAh | Similar endurance, but the tablet may last longer due to lower power demands. |
Charging Speed | 15W | 18W | The Spark 10 5G charges slightly faster. |
Connectivity & Extras
Feature | Samsung Galaxy Tab A7 Lite | Tecno Spark 10 5G | Real-World Implications |
---|---|---|---|
5G Support | No | Yes | The Spark 10 5G is future-proof for faster networks. |
Bluetooth | 5.0 | 5.1 LE | The Spark 10 5G has better power efficiency and audio codecs. |
Dual SIM | No | Yes | The Spark 10 5G is better for travelers or work/personal separation. |
Audio | Dolby Atmos, Stereo Speakers | Basic audio | The tablet has better sound for movies and music. |
2. Key Insights
Samsung Galaxy Tab A7 Lite Strengths
✅ Bigger screen – Better for reading, streaming, and light productivity.
✅ Superior audio – Dolby Atmos and stereo speakers enhance media consumption.
✅ Longer battery life – Despite similar capacity, the tablet’s lower power demands help.
Tecno Spark 10 5G Strengths
✅ Much faster performance – 3x higher benchmark scores, better for gaming and multitasking.
✅ Better cameras – 50MP main vs. 8MP, plus a usable selfie camera.
✅ 5G & future-proofing – Faster network speeds and newer Bluetooth.
✅ More storage & RAM – 256GB + 8GB vs. 64GB + 4GB.
Trade-Offs
- The Tab A7 Lite is slow for anything beyond basic tasks.
- The Spark 10 5G has a smaller screen, making it worse for media.
